Ingredients

List of Ingredients for White Sangria

To make white sangria, you need the following ingredients:

– 2 cups white grape juice

– 1 cup sparkling water or lemon-lime soda

– 1 cup peach or apricot nectar

– 1 medium green apple, thinly sliced

– 1 cup fresh strawberries, halved

– 1 orange, thinly sliced

– 1 lemon, thinly sliced

– A handful of fresh mint leaves

– Ice cubes

Recommended White Wine Options

For a great white sangria, I suggest using a dry white wine. Here are some options:

– Sauvignon Blanc

– Pinot Grigio

– Chardonnay

These wines have nice fruit notes and mix well. Keep the wine light. Avoid overly sweet options for balance.

Additional Fruits and Flavor Enhancers

You can add more fruits for extra flavor. Here are some tasty choices:

– Pineapple chunks

– Raspberries

– Kiwi slices

Experiment with herbs, too. Try a sprig of basil or rosemary. They give a unique taste. For sweetness, consider adding a splash of agave syrup or honey. This can help balance the tartness of citrus fruits.

Step-by-Step Instructions

Detailed Preparation Steps

To make white sangria, you need a pitcher and some fun. Start by pouring 2 cups of white grape juice into the pitcher. Next, add 1 cup of peach or apricot nectar. Stir them well. This mix is the base of your drink. Now, slowly add 1 cup of sparkling water or lemon-lime soda. Adding it slowly keeps the bubbles fresh.

Then, it’s time for the fruits. Slice 1 medium green apple and add it. Halve 1 cup of fresh strawberries and toss them in too. Don’t forget to slice 1 orange and 1 lemon thinly. Add these slices to the mix. As you stir, gently press the fruit. This helps their juices blend into the sangria.

Next, toss in a handful of fresh mint leaves. This step adds a nice, fresh scent. Cover your pitcher and let it chill in the fridge for at least 30 minutes. This waiting time helps the flavors mix well.

Tips for Maintaining Fizz

To keep your sangria bubbly, add the sparkling water last. Pour it in gently. If you need to serve later, wait until just before serving to add the fizz. This way, your drink stays lively and fun.

Serving Suggestions for an Attractive Presentation

When you’re ready to serve, grab some glasses and fill them with ice cubes. Pour the chilled sangria over the ice. Make sure each glass has fruit. For a pretty touch, garnish with more mint leaves and a slice of citrus. This not only looks nice but also makes each sip even better. Enjoy your refreshing drink!

Tips & Tricks

Best Practices for Flavor Infusion

To make your white sangria shine, start with the right wine. I recommend a dry white wine, like Sauvignon Blanc. This wine adds a crisp taste. Next, focus on your fruit. Use fresh, ripe fruit for the best flavor. Slice them thin to help the juices mix well. Let your sangria sit in the fridge for at least 30 minutes. This time helps the flavors blend perfectly.

Adjusting Sweetness and Acidity

Finding the right balance is key. If your sangria tastes too sweet, add more citrus. Squeeze in fresh lemon or lime juice. This adds acidity and brightens the drink. If it’s too tart for your taste, stir in a bit of sugar or honey. Start with a teaspoon and taste as you go. Remember, you can always add more but can’t take it out!
